Transaction 3ef0e275891acb0d4f7898d8120497bd226642136727e614ea91e38c66226201

3 Input
1 Outputs
  • 3ef0e275891acb0d4f7898d8120497bd226642136727e614ea91e38c66226201:0
  • value  28889010
    address  1Pkiv7U1CCqy2jpEfrcLC2N6gsFp7gtZG8